The name 'Huan' (欢) is a Chinese given name that translates directly to 'happiness' or 'joy.' It often conveys a sense of delight and positive energy. In Chinese culture, names like Huan encapsulate the parents' wishes for their child to live a joyful and prosperous life.

Cultural Significance of Huan

In Chinese culture, the name Huan is significant because it embodies a universal desire for joy and happiness. It is a popular name choice that reflects traditional values of positivity and well-being.

Huan Wen

Military and Political Leader

Huan Wen was a prominent general and regent during the Eastern Jin dynasty, known for his military prowess and political influence in 4th century China.

  • General of the Jin Dynasty
  • Led successful military campaigns to consolidate Northern China

Huan Xuan

Political Figure

Huan Xuan was a warlord who briefly usurped the throne, representing a turbulent period in Chinese history.

  • Declared himself emperor of a short-lived state
  • Known for his rebellion against the Jin Dynasty

Fun Fact About Huan

The character 欢 in the name Huan is also used in the word 欢迎 (huānyíng), which means 'welcome,' signifying warmth and openness.

The Joyful Meaning Behind 'Huan' Names carry more than just sounds; they carry stories, hopes, and values. 'Huan' (欢) is a Chinese name that directly translates to 'happiness' or 'joy.' Imagine naming your child with a word that embodies the essence of delight and positive energy. It’s like giving them a lifelong blessing wrapped in a simple, elegant syllable.

In my experience, names like Huan reflect the deep-seated values in Chinese culture, where a name is a wish for the child's future. Parents who choose Huan are essentially wishing their child a life full of joy and warm connections.

The Etymological Roots and Pronunciation Pronounced as 'HWAN' (/xwán/ in IPA), the name is straightforward yet melodious. The character itself is used in everyday Chinese words like 欢迎 (huānyíng), meaning 'welcome,' adding layers of warmth and friendliness to the name’s aura.

Historical Figures Who Bore the Name Huan is not just a modern choice; it carries historical weight. Take Huan Wen (312–373 CE), a Jin dynasty general renowned for his military leadership. His legacy is one of strength and strategy during turbulent times. Similarly, Huan Xuan and Huan Chong were notable figures who influenced Chinese history through their political and military roles. Knowing these figures adds a regal and resilient dimension to the name.
